News Xulfr

Le point sur les IDE XUL

lundi 22 novembre 2004 à 10:54

Xulmaker est le projet d'environnement de développement pour XUL le plus ancien. Mais il est malheureusement toujours en cours de développement et n'évolue quasiment pas. Une version 0.5.1 est tout de même sortie cet été corrigeant nombre de bugs, et ayant une meilleure compatibilité avec des versions plus récentes de Mozilla (mais 1.6 maximum !). Elle n'apporte cependant aucune nouveauté.

D'autres initiatives de projet d'IDE commencent à apparaître. Il y a par exemple Mozcreator qui vient tout juste de débuter, et entièrement en JAVA. Il ne semble pas qu'il propose pour l'instant la création de fichier XUL en wysiwyg. À surveiller tout de même.

Brendan Eich déplore que son idée d'extensions XUL pour Eclipse, qu'il avait évoqué lors de la conférence des développeurs en février dernier, n'ait pas encore vu le jour. Il note cependant l'existence récente d'une extension pour Eclipse, pour un langage similaire à XUL, LZX, utilisé dans Open Laslo. Il serait peut-être intérressant de l'adapter pour XUL.

PS : à noter aussi un projet qui est sur le point de naître : MozIDE

Du Xul chez OVH

mardi 30 novembre 2004 à 12:19

XUL commence à faire des émules un peu partout. Pour preuve, l'hébergeur OVH propose une page XUL pour visualiser l'activité de leurs serveurs en temps réèl (Source : Pascal Chevrel) : http://www.ovh.com/fr/support/charges/plans.xul (fonctionne dans les versions récentes de Firefox et Mozilla). Vous pouvez comparer le résultat avec son équivalent HTML, beaucoup moins attractif du coup ;-)

Une page XUL pour afficher l'interface graphique, un fichier RDF généré dynamiquement pour alimenter en données le composant affichant la liste : c'est un exemple typique et trivial de ce qu'on peut faire avec du XUL dans une application Web.

Xulrunner dans une tinderbox

mercredi 24 novembre 2004 à 12:12

Darin Fisher nous donne des nouvelles sur Xulrunner, applicatif qui permettra de lancer des applications XUL sans avoir besoin de Mozilla ou Firefox, (voir la nouvelle précédente sur le sujet).

Xulrunner a été intégré dans le tronc cvs de Mozilla en septembre dernier et il y a maintenant une tinderbox (machine de test) à la fondation réservé pour ce projet, dont on peut voir l'activité sur le web. Mais pour le moment il ne semble pas y avoir de "nightly builds" disponibles pour tester soi-même.

Cependant, dans les mois à venir, une première version alpha devrait voir le jour ! Ça fait long à attendre encore, mais le projet avance.

Support de Mysql dans Mozilla

mardi 30 novembre 2004 à 11:55

Le projet SQL de Mozilla.org avance. Il a pour objectif d'apporter des interfaces et des objets XPCom pour accéder nativement à des bases de données à partir d'une application XUL. Ces composants permettent également de fournir une source de données RDF pour les gabarits XUL (template) et les arbres, source RDF contenant les données issues d'une requête.

L'accés à la base de donnée Postgresql était possible depuis le début du projet. Neil Deakin annonce que Jan et lui ont ajouté le support de MySql et SqlLite. Pour pouvoir en profiter, il faut récupérer les sources de mozilla et compiler les composants correspondants ( voir la section BaseDeDonnées du wiki). Une documentation sur leur utilisation est prévue ultérieurement.

Le tutoriel XUL est complet !

dimanche 28 novembre 2004 à 10:20

Il y a un an, à une semaine près, xulfr.org lançait le projet de traduction du tutoriel XUL du site XULPlanet.com, avec l'accord de son auteur, Neil Deakin.

J'ai le plaisir de vous annoncer, qu'enfin, la traduction est terminée ! Le tutoriel est complet et est même dorénavant disponible en téléchargement pour une consultation hors-ligne.

Quelques chiffres :

  • 80 articles traduits
  • 26 traducteurs
  • des heures de relecture et de correction.

Je remercie tous les traducteurs qui sont venus aider (par ordre alphabétique) : Julien Appert, Alain Boquet, Adrien Bustany, BrainBooster, Caffeine, Cyril Cheneson, Sylvain Costard, Romain D., Cyril Delalande, Dkoo, Durandal, Julien Etaix, Chaddaï Fouché, Gnunux, Damien Hardy, Nadine Henry, Gérard L., Maximilien, Medspx, Jean Pascal Milcent, Adrien Montoille, Gabriel de Perthuis, Tristan Rivoallan, Vincent S., Benoit Salandre.

Je remercie tout particulièrement Alain Boquet, qui non seulement a beaucoup participé à la traduction, mais a aussi passé de nombreuses heures à relire les articles traduits et ainsi à m'aider dans la finalisation du tutoriel.

Bonne lecture !

PS : pour ceux qui avait déjà lu la traduction du chapitre 1 depuis plusieurs semaines, sachez que Neil Deakin, l'auteur du tutoriel, a rajouté pas mal d'information, et bien entendu, nous avons mis à jour la traduction depuis peu.

Nouvelle roadmap Firefox 2.0

jeudi 25 novembre 2004 à 10:19

Le futur pour Firefox 2.0 a été dévoilé sur le site mozilla.org. Cette roadmap précise que Firefox sera le "moteur" des évolutions sur Gecko et Xulrunner. On peut donc s'attendre à des avançées significatives sur ces deux composants durant l'année 2005.

Deux versions majeurs, 1.1 et 1.5 seront sorties avant la version 2.0. Mais seule la date de la version 1.1 est déterminée : mars 2005. Durant toutes ces phases de développement, des améliorations sont prévues sur le gestionnaire de marque-pages, le système d'extensions, de mise à jour, sur la barre de recherche et autres parties de l'interface. Des améliorations sur l'accessibilité sont aussi prévues.

Bien sûr, cette roadmap n'est pas figée, des nouveautés vont certainement apparaître les mois prochains. Stay tune.

Serverpost

jeudi 18 novembre 2004 à 16:29

Serverpost est un composant XBL qui permettent de combiner les avantages des formulaires HTML et du XUL. En clair, ce composant prend en charge l'envoi des données du formulaire et la réception de la réponse. Il effectue donc pour vous les requêtes HTTP.

Bien qu'il en soit déjà à sa version 0.6, le site du projet vient juste d'ouvrir sur mozdev.org : http://serverpost.mozdev.org/

Déployer Firefox sur tout un réseau

mardi 16 novembre 2004 à 13:35

Bob Templeton a réalisé un tutoriel pour apprendre à déployer Firefox pré-configuré sur plusieurs postes. Il est donc déstiné aux administrateurs réseaux.

Premier anniversaire

vendredi 5 novembre 2004 à 10:43

Le 30 octobre dernier, Xulfr soufflait sa première bougie. En un an, le site a bien progressé, tant en terme de visiteurs (500-600 visiteurs par jour en moyenne) que de contenu. Un forum et une rubrique de news ont vu le jour tandis que le projet de traduction du tutoriel de notre confrère anglophone xulplanet a démarré.

À l'heure où Firefox commence à débarquer massivement sur les PCs de Monsieur Tout-le-monde, de nouveaux utilisateurs vont très certainement vouloir apprendre à développer des extensions pour ce navigateur, ou à utiliser le framework de Mozilla pour réaliser des logiciels complets. En clair : il va y avoir des nouveaux venus dans le monde de XUL, XBL, JavaScript, XPCOM etc..

Afin de répondre à cette future demande en matière de connaissance, les objectifs de Xulfr pour l'année qui suit sont donc les suivants :

  • Premier point prioritaire : terminer la traduction du tutoriel de Xulplanet, ce qui ne saurait tarder si on regarde l'avancement des traductions (bouclage pour la fin du mois de novembre ?)
  • Continuer à completer le wiki en mettant l'accent sur des articles et tutoriels, des trucs et astuces pour le développement, apprentissage du développement de composants XPCOM etc. Par contre, pour ce qui est la référence des langages (XUL, XBL, objets XPCOM), étant donné que c'est un boulot énorme à documenter et surtout à maintenir, nous renvoyons nos lecteurs aux rubriques correspondantes sur le site http://xulplanet.com. Toutefois, si par un heureux hasard il y aurait des volontaires pour completer la rubrique référence sur le wiki, ils sont les bienvenus ;-)
  • Améliorer le site afin qu'il soit accessible tant aux développeurs, qu'aux décideurs.
  • Proposer encore plus d'outils d'aide au développement

Si vous avez des idées d'améliorations pour le site, n'hésitez pas à en parler dans les commentaires de cette news ou sur le forum

Firefox 1.0 est sorti

mardi 9 novembre 2004 à 17:25

La tant attendue version 1.0 du navigateur Firefox est sortie aujourd'hui ! Ce navigateur fiable, sécurisé, respectant les standards du web offre des fonctionnalités avançées aux utilisateurs : navigation par onglets, blocage des popups, gestion fine de ses données personnelles etc..

Firefox offre aussi un excellent système d'extension qui ravira les utilisateurs avançées. Ainsi le site http://update.mozilla.org offre plus de 70 extensions permettant d'avoir un navigateur adapté à ses besoins, et une quarantaine de thèmes pour le décorer à son goût.

Mais cette nouvelle version de Firefox offre surtout une plateforme stable pour développer des applications métiers et autres logiciels, que ce soit des applications web (en utilisant XUL plutôt que HTML pour réaliser l'interface graphique), que des applications desktops, profitant alors de toutes les API du framework de Firefox pour utiliser les dernières technologies standards et de son système de mis à jour automatique pour un déploiement simplifié.

Firefox 1.0 dévoile sous les projecteurs une nouvelle manière de développer des sites et des applications !

Pour le télécharger, disponible en plusieurs langues : http://www.mozilla-europe.org/fr ou http://www.mozilla.org/products/firefox/


Copyright © 2003-2013 association xulfr, 2013-2016 Laurent Jouanneau - Informations légales.

Mozilla® est une marque déposée de la fondation Mozilla.
Mozilla.org™, Firefox™, Thunderbird™, Mozilla Suite™ et XUL™ sont des marques de la fondation Mozilla.